Transaction f656b40e1fec61f4a51b9ab79c0fbecf3f15ba9e5ebfe30842f63d656f8e27ac
2 Input
2 Outputs
- f656b40e1fec61f4a51b9ab79c0fbecf3f15ba9e5ebfe30842f63d656f8e27ac:0
- f656b40e1fec61f4a51b9ab79c0fbecf3f15ba9e5ebfe30842f63d656f8e27ac:1
value 10000000
address 1BBcurgazAPwk3saAm4KYCdo6Cvpar6qzA
value 158062
address 1CbcmY9q8uv5f4syfQpwjxz5Bk42tzsZK8